Create your own point-based grading scale Categorize … WebMay 13, 2013 · I. The Bell Curve. Normalizes scores using a statistical technique to reshape the distribution into a bell curve. An instructor then assigns a grade (e.g., C+) to the middle (median) score and determines grade thresholds based on the distance of scores from this reference point. Understanding Normal ACT Test Score And How ACT Scoring Works ... ritchie highway lumberWebMay 9, 2024 · Though Canvas offers the ability to curve students' grades, we recommend caution in using this feature because the grade curving cannot be undone. Pre-curving grade histories will be available, but the curving action is irreversible.
